After the secret talks held in Muscat, the capital of Oman, the atmosphere in the Gulf has suddenly become heated. On Saturday, February 7, US President’s special envoy Steve Witkoff and Jared Kushner visited America’s largest ship ‘USS Abraham Lincoln’ parked in the Arabian Sea. In response to this, Iran has also shown its preparedness and has directly warned America.

If attacked, American bases will be the target
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Aragchi has clearly said that if America takes any military action, Iran will not blow up its neighboring countries but will blow up the American military bases there. With this statement, Iran has taken out its dangerous ‘Khorramshahr-4’ ballistic missile and deployed it at its underground places.
Even during the talks, the tension between the two countries has not diminished. Iran says it will not make any compromise on reducing its missile forces, while America wants Iran to reduce its weapons and talk on human rights.
Face-off at sea and new restrictions
On February 3, just before the US officials’ visit, the US Navy shot down an Iranian ‘Shahed-139’ drone which had come too close to their ship. Apart from this, on February 7, America has imposed new stringent sanctions on 14 of its ships and 15 companies to put pressure on Iran.
US President Donald Trump has signed a new order on 6 February. Under this, a tax of up to 25% can be imposed on countries that do business with Iran. The table below contains key events of the last few days:
3 February US Navy shoots down Iranian drone 6 February US-Iran talks in Oman and Trump’s new order 7 February US envoys visit naval fleet and new sanctions
